How they compare

Bulgaria currently reports 12,286 BoP, current US$ per person against 11,270 BoP, current US$ per person in Oman, a difference of 1,016 BoP, current US$ per person.

That makes Bulgaria's figure about 1.1 times Oman's.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 45 shared years of data; in 1980 it was Oman ahead.

Bulgaria ranks 61st and Oman ranks 63rd of 200 countries.

Oman has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Bulgaria Oman Difference Ahead
1980s 1,171 BoP, current US$ per person 2,713 BoP, current US$ per person 1,542 BoP, current US$ per person Oman
1990s 740.21 BoP, current US$ per person 2,825 BoP, current US$ per person 2,085 BoP, current US$ per person Oman
2000s 2,937 BoP, current US$ per person 6,099 BoP, current US$ per person 3,162 BoP, current US$ per person Oman
2010s 5,535 BoP, current US$ per person 9,933 BoP, current US$ per person 4,398 BoP, current US$ per person Oman
2020s 9,494 BoP, current US$ per person 10,607 BoP, current US$ per person 1,113 BoP, current US$ per person Oman

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
